1989 Razzberry USA Strat Plus routed for Schaller Floyd. Great-sounding body, but you'll have to fix the crack near the lower bridge stud (also one near the neck pocket, but that's just a finish crack and purely cosmetic). Otherwise, it's in decent shape for a 29-year-old guitar. Light swirling and belt-buckle rash as you'd expect. I'm pretty sure it's alder but don't quote me on that. Weighs around 5 pounds, give or take an ounce. I'll even throw in your choice of gold (brand-new) or vintage (aka, original Fender) chrome recessed Strat top jack, Schaller strap locks and the original tremolo cover plate. $150 or best offer.
